Chapter 79 "The Black Sanctuary"
"Get out of the way!" Aksu roared, and one of the arbitrators was sent flying without dodging.
A Terminator soldier attacked the war boss from the side.
The orc war leader swung his right fist at the terminator.
With a loud bang, the Terminator warrior was sent flying.
The arbitrators fired wildly at the war boss, but all their fire was blocked by the heavy plate armor.
Van Grey suddenly remembered how he had dealt with the Hive Overlord before.
"Attack its legs!"
Vangrae quickly approached the war chief, and after a flash of silver afterimage, Vangrae appeared next to the orc war chief, his sharp power sword aimed at the war chief's knee.
A spark flashed, and jet-black engine oil gushed out from the oil pipe.
The reason why the Orc Warlord is so big yet so agile is mainly due to "mechanical assistance." Van Grey's thinking is correct; this sword strike did have some effect.
Enraged, the orc war leader reached out his left hand to grab Vangrey, who easily dodged and slashed at the war leader's massive steel hand with his sword.
The powerful sword, capable of cutting through iron like mud, only left a mark on the giant steel hand, demonstrating that the giant steel hand of the orc war leader was not made of ordinary materials.
Missing his first grab, the orc war leader swung his right fist again.
This time, Van Grey couldn't dodge the heavy punch no matter what, and the enormous force sent him flying.
A Space Marine wielding a hammer charged forward and swung it at the back of the Orc warchief's leg.
With a loud thud, the power hammer slammed heavily into the back of the leader's knee, catching him off guard and forcing him to kneel on one knee.
Four Ironclad Terminators pounced forward, their power axes slashing down from various angles.
With a roar, the War Boss swung his massive right fist at the Terminators. Three Terminators were swept away, while only one Terminator's power axe struck the War Boss in the neck. The heavy plate armor was insufficient to withstand the power axe's attack, and the axe severed the War Boss's carotid artery, splattering blood all over the Terminator.
"Roar!" The Orc war leader roared, grabbing the Terminator warrior with his left hand and pulling with all his might. His massive steel claws shattered the Ironclad Terminator's armor, along with the Space Marine inside. It looked like the Terminator was about to be crushed to death.
Aksu pounced again, his sharp power axe slashing at the war leader's arm.
Aksu's furious strike was extremely powerful; with a single axe stroke, he severed the Warlord's massive steel hand, and the Space Marine fell with it.
The instant the giant steel hand was severed, Van Grey rushed forward and thrust his sharp power sword toward the War Boss's neck. The heavy plate armor could not withstand the power sword's thrust, and the War Boss's neck was pierced through.
A pierced neck is a severe injury to the war boss, rendering it unable to stand up.
Arbitrators swarmed forward, hacking at the war boss with various weapons.
This time, the leader could no longer hold on, and his huge body collapsed to the ground.
Once the war boss was killed, the other orc big guys were easy to deal with. Only after the last orc big guy was killed did everyone relax.
"Master, all the Orks have been killed!" a Space Marine reported to Van Grey.
Van Grey nodded and said, "Everyone stay alert, the orcs will be here soon."
He had barely finished speaking when three giant ancient chickens walked over from a distance.
As the giant chicken approached, cannonballs rained down, and violent explosions rang out around the Space Marines.
Several arbitrators who couldn't dodge in time were blown to the ground.
A group of burly orcs charged forward and began fighting the Space Marines.
With the interference of the three giant chickens, the Space Marines were unable to focus on protecting the Star Guardians.
A hulking orc charged into the midst of the Kadian warriors, and with a single sweep of his greatsword, several Kadian warriors were killed.
"Retreat!" Russell commanded as he drew his Bloodthirster to meet the orc giant.
As the leader of the Kadian warriors, he couldn't hide in the background, even though he knew he was no match for the orc giants.
Russell stood face to face with the giant orc. One was nearly six meters tall while the other was only 181 cm. The difference between the two was simply too great.
The orc's big, blood-red eyes were fixed on Russell, but Russell met the orc's gaze without flinching.
Russell launched the first attack, letting out a low growl of "Blessing of the Emperor!" before charging swiftly toward the orc hulking figure.
Enraged that a human, as insignificant as an ant, dared to attack him, the orc giant brandished his greatsword and slashed down at Russell.
The greatsword was like a door to Russell; he quickly dodged, and the greatsword slashed deeply into the soil. The orc giant had used tremendous force.
The Blood Drinker swiftly slashed at the orc's leg, but with a "clang," the Blood Drinker bounced back; indeed, his full-force attack had failed to break through the orc's defense.
Russell's heart sank when his first attack missed. He was confident that the Blood Drinker was sharp enough during the attack; he had even cut through the python's scales, so what was heavy plate armor to him? The result, however, surprised him greatly.
The big orc kicked Russell flying, as if swatting away a fly from a mortal.
After eliminating Russell, it charged into the Cardian warriors and wreaked havoc, killing countless Cardian warriors in an instant.
Russell struggled to his feet, wiping the blood from the corner of his mouth. His eyes blazed with fury. Despite his anger, Russell still dared not use "Soul of the Giant Serpent." Perhaps "Soul of the Giant Serpent" could instantly kill the orc giant, but the consumption was too great, and he could not use it lightly.
Just as Russell was at his wit's end, chaos erupted behind the orcs as another Space Marine clad in Unyielding Terminator armor charged forward.
The Space Marine was so fast that Russell couldn't keep up; wherever his sword flashed, hordes of orc giants fell.
Russell had never seen such a powerful Space Marine before.
The Space Marine swiftly cut through the Orcs, even shredding three Ancient Chickens to pieces.
Soon the Space Marine arrived before Vangrae and Aksu, and the two immediately knelt on one knee before him.
Russell was stunned. He couldn't understand what was going on. The Captain of the Van Greys was kneeling before a Space Marine?
The newcomer removed his helmet, revealing a very heroic and resolute face.
"Which warband are you from?"
"The Silver Knights, Commander Van Grey!"
"The name of the Holy Shield, Second Company Commander Aksu!"
Both of them respectfully stated the names of their respective legions.
The newcomer nodded and said: "My name is Sigismund, the Supreme Marshal of the Black Templar. My genetic father is Rog Dorn."
